What is management level analyst?
Management analysts – also known as management consultants – are typically hired to find ways to improve an organization’s efficiency and increase profits. Management consultants collect and analyze data about how a company works and then recommend changes that will decrease costs or boost revenue.
How long does it take to be a management analyst?
Pursuing a bachelor’s degree Aspiring management analysts should consider a four-year program in management, accounting, business administration or finance. In these programs, students complete coursework in organizational behavior, management theory and statistical analysis.

Is being a management analyst stressful?
Management analysts usually divide their time between their offices and the client’s site. Because they must spend a significant amount of time with clients, analysts travel frequently. Analysts may experience stress, especially when trying to meet a client’s demands on a tight schedule.
How many hours do you work as a management analyst?
Work Environment Management analysts may travel frequently to meet with clients. Some work more than 40 hours per week.
